Device & OS
• Device model: Samsung Galaxy S9+
• Android version: Android 10
• VInstall version: 0.4.3
Bug
After updating to VInstall 0.4.3, every time I launch the app it shows the “Allow Shizuku permission” prompt again.
I grant the permission once during that session and everything works normally, but the next time I open VInstall the prompt re-appears (exactly once per launch).
Expected behavior
The Shizuku permission should only be requested once (the first time the app needs it). After granting it, the prompt should never appear again on future launches.
Actual behavior
Prompt appears on every single app launch.
Steps to reproduce
- Grant Shizuku permission to VInstall (via the prompt or in the Stellar app).
- Close VInstall completely.
- Re-open VInstall.
- The Shizuku permission prompt appears again.
Log
2026-04-13-02-37-45_618.zip
Additional notes
This started immediately after updating from 0.4.2-hotfix2. The old crashing issue seems resolved in 0.4.3.
